Bucs Battle to the Bitter End in 3-2 Loss to Falcons
FITCHBURG, Mass -- Volleyball traveled to Fitchburg on Wednesday to take on Fitchburg State in conference play. After taking the first two sets, the Bucs lost sets three and four. In the fifth set, typically only to 15 points, the teams went way over that total with both teams desperately wanting the conference victory. In the end, the Falcons took the fifth and final set, 27-25.
The Basics
Final: Falcons 3, Buccaneers 2 (23-25, 11-25, 25-17, 25-20, 27-25)
Records: Maritime 5-16 (1-4)
Fitchburg 3-18 (1-4)
Inside The Numbers
Maritime
- Shayla Narodowg led all players with 18 kills in the match. Ashleigh Catlett added 10 kills of her own.
- Erin Donlan posted a career and match-high 33 assists in the loss.
- On the serve, Narodowg had a match-high seven aces.
- Defensively, Holly Sanders notched a career and match-high 53 digs. Donlan had 23 digs, and Catlett had 21.
- At the net, Sydney McCarthy had a match-high three solo blocks. Natalie Gale added two solo and one block assist.
- The Bucs posted a 0.050 hitting percentage and 64 points.
Fitchburg
- Stephanie Sardella had a team-high 17 kills. Samantha Azzari had 14 of her own.
- Madison Keohane had 29 assists to lead the Falcons, and Mia Vestal had 21.
- On the serve, Sardella had six aces in the win.
- Defensively, Sardella posted 30 digs, Maribelis Alcantara had 29, and Sydney Nortelus racked up 20.
- At the net, Gabrielle Griffither and Gwynneth Norman each had a solo block, Diana Sosa-Martinez had two block assists.
- Fitchburg posted a 0.079 hitting percentage and scored 78 points.
